Recognizing Bail Bond Terminology

What key terms should one recognize with when traversing the world of Bail bonds? Understanding basic terms is important for steering Bail bonds effectively. The term "Bail" describes the amount of money or property required to secure a defendant's launch from custodianship, ensuring their look in court. "Bail bond" denotes a contract in between the offender, the court, and a Bail bondsman, that gives the Bail amount for a cost, typically 10-15% of the total Bail. "Security" may be needed, entailing properties pledged to ensure settlement if the accused stops working to appear (bail bonds service). "Costs" is the non-refundable cost paid to the Bail bondsman for their solutions. In addition, "forfeit" happens if the defendant does not follow court appearances, causing the loss of the Bail amount. Experience with these terms empowers individuals to make informed decisions throughout the Bail procedure



The Different Sorts Of Bail Bonds

When taking into consideration the numerous alternatives for securing an offender's release, one might question the different kinds of Bail bonds available. The most usual type is the surety bond, where a bondsman guarantees the full Bail quantity for a cost, usually around 10%. Another option is a money bond, which calls for the defendant or their household to pay the entire Bail amount in money upfront, refundable upon court look. Building bonds involve using property as security to secure the Bail amount. Additionally, some territories supply government bonds for government offenses, which have certain demands. Ultimately, there are immigration bonds for individuals restrained by migration authorities. Each type serves a special function and might differ pertaining to expense and needs, making it essential for novice individuals to comprehend their alternatives extensively prior to continuing.

The Bail Bond Refine Explained

Comprehending the bail bond process is important for anybody maneuvering the judicial system. When a person is apprehended, a court establishes a Bail quantity based on the severity of the costs and the defendant's trip risk. A bail bond can be gotten with a licensed Bail bondsman if the Bail is expensive. The accused or co-signer typically pays a non-refundable fee, normally around 10% of the complete Bail amount.

As soon as the bond is secured, the bail bondsman ensures the court that the accused will stand for all arranged hearings. If the offender stops working to show up, the bondsman is in charge of paying the complete Bail quantity, which can cause healing efforts to situate the person. Throughout this process, communication with the Bail bondsman is important, as they supply support and assistance to ensure conformity with court needs and responsibilities.

Your Rights as a Co-Signer

Co-signers play a necessary function in the bail bond process, as they are legally in charge of making certain that the offender abides by the problems of the bond. This responsibility comes with particular rights that co-signers ought to know. To start with, co-signers can receive complete disclosure relating to the regards to the bond, consisting of costs and potential obligations. They additionally have the right to be notified if the accused breaks any problems of the bond, such bail bonds as failing to show up in court.

In addition, co-signers can request a copy of the bail bond arrangement for their records. They are qualified to recognize the consequences of their monetary dedication, including the possibility of being held liable for the sum total of the bond if the offender does not comply. Inevitably, co-signers have the right to withdraw their support under certain conditions, although this might need notifying the bail bond agent in advancement.

Usual Mistakes to Stay Clear Of

Maneuvering the bail bond procedure can be complicated, and co-signers commonly make several common blunders that can result in difficulties. One significant mistake is stopping working to check out the entire Bail arrangement, which might have vital conditions that impact their financial obligation. Furthermore, co-signers in some cases take too lightly the relevance of recognizing the accused's scenario, including their court dates and potential consequences of non-compliance. An additional frequent mistake is neglecting to maintain communication with the bondsman, which can prevent the procedure if problems develop. Co-signers may additionally ignore the economic ramifications of Bail, not totally realizing the fees included or the opportunity of shedding security. Ultimately, they could think that once Bail is posted, their obligation finishes, not recognizing that they continue to be liable till the situation is resolved. Preventing these challenges can significantly reduce the bail bond experience for novice customers.

How Do Bail Bond Companies Determine the Costs Quantity?

Bail bond firms normally establish the costs quantity based upon the complete Bail quantity, the risk connected with the accused, and the business's plans - bail bonds service. Factors like the offender's criminal background and trip threat additionally influence this choice

Can I Work Out the Regards To a Bail Bond?

The possibility of bargaining bail bond terms differs by company. Some bail bondsmans might use versatility, while others adhere strictly to developed guidelines. It is a good idea to go over alternatives directly with the bail bond representative for clearness.

What Happens if the Offender Misses Their Court Day?

A bench warrant might be released for their arrest if an accused misses their court day. In addition, the bail bond may be forfeited, causing economic consequences for the co-signer and possible legal issues for the accused.

Are Bail Bond Fees Refundable After the Situation Ends?

Bail bond fees are usually non-refundable, no matter the situation outcome. This fee makes up the bond agent for the solution of safeguarding the accused's release, covering risks and administrative prices entailed in the procedure.

Can I Use Collateral Various Other Than Building for a Bail Bond?

The inquiry of utilizing security beyond building for a bail bond often occurs. Lots of bail bond agents accept different forms of collateral, such as vehicles or useful products, but plans may differ by firm and territory.
